Meghan began coaching CrossFit classes in 2010 and started programming for a variety of individual athletes in 2012. A lifelong athlete, Meghan grew up playing soccer and first discovered her love for training while working at Gold’s Gym in high school. Her passion for fitness deepened when she found CrossFit in 2009—and she was hooked.
As an athlete, Meghan is a 5-time Individual CrossFit Regional qualifier, competing four times individually and once on a team at the CrossFit Games. Throughout her career, she’s earned multiple coaching certifications, including CrossFit Level 2, CrossFit Weightlifting, Movement and Mobility, and OPT’s CCP Assessment, Program Design, Nutrition, and Lifestyle Coaching.
After retiring from competitive CrossFit, Meghan expanded her knowledge of movement and health by becoming a certified yoga teacher. She brings a well-rounded approach to coaching, helping everyday athletes push their performance, develop strength and skills, and build confidence through training.
Whether she’s guiding someone through their first pull-up or helping an athlete prep for an event, Meghan loves being part of the journey and watching people thrive through fitness.
She currently coaches classes at Training Think Tank. Outside the gym, she enjoys spending time outdoors with her husband and son.
